Date: 5/12/1939 Sex: F ReadingID: 8307
This Psychic Reading given by Edgar Cayce at his home on Arctic Crescent, Virginia Beach, Va., this 12th day of May, 1939, in accordance with request made by the son - Mr. […], New Associate Sponsored Membership in the Ass”n for Research & Enlightenment, Inc., recommended by Mr. […] [[1826]”s husband].
[Edgar Cayce; Gertrude Cayce, Conductor; Gladys Davis, Steno.]
Time of Reading 3:35 to 3:50 P. M. Eastern Standard Time. Brooklyn, N.Y.
-
GC: You will go over this body carefully, examine it thoroughly, and tell me the conditions you find at the present time; giving the cause of the existing conditions, also suggestions for help and relief of this body. You will answer the questions which may be submitted, as I ask them:
-
EC: Yes, we have the body, [1882].
-
As we find, there is rather the complication of disturbances.
-
Much of the highly nervous tension arises from congestions being produced by resentments, as well as - now - producing very definite disturbances with the liver, its activities, the whole of the hepatic circulation; the very acute pains at times through portions of the limbs, and very severe conditions with the head, an upset stomach at times, and the general disturbance of the assimilating system and the whole nervous system.
-
As we would find, in making applications for the body, - there must first be a prayerful, meditative attitude; leaving off all of those disturbances which have been so a part of the body.
-
Then, we would begin to apply the Hot Castor Oil Packs EVERY evening when ready to retire. Have three thicknesses of flannel that would cover the areas from the lower portion of the right rib to the lower portion of the caecum area; covering, then, the liver, the gall duct, the whole of the right portion, and extending over the greater portion of the abdomen. The flannel would be dipped in the Oil and wrung out, rather than the Oil being poured over the flannel, see? Then, after applying, put coverings over same to protect the clothing - such as a heavy pad, towel or cloth. Then put the electric pad over same, and keep this on for at least an hour and a half each evening, as hot as the body can very well stand it. Do this each evening for five days.
-
After the fifth day, begin with taking Eno Salt twice each day; about half a teaspoonful morning and evening. Continue taking this until there are thorough eliminations through the alimentary canal.
-
Then take an Epsom Salts Tub Bath; that is, to about twenty gallons of water, as hot as the body can stand same, put at least ten to twelve pounds of Epsom Salts. Lie in this (with the whole body covered except the head, you see) for at least twenty to thirty minutes. This will tend to weaken the body a bit; but rub the body down thoroughly afterwards (immediately after the Bath, you see) with GRAIN alcohol; not rub alcohol but GRAIN Alcohol.
-
Rest then for at least a day and a half.
-
Then begin again with the Castor Oil Packs, giving these each evening then for at least three days.
-
Then begin with the Eno Salt again, taking it for two, three, four, five, six, eight to ten days, in the same way and manner as before. Eno Salts - the fruit salts, you see.
-
Throughout the period beware of those foods with a great deal of fat. More of the vegetables and fruits. If meat is taken, let it be fish, fowl or lamb.
-
We would give a gentle massage of evening with Cocoa Butter along the spine; following same with the vibrations from an electrically driven Vibrator.
-
These as we find should bring, by the time the second round of these have been given, a much nearer normal force for the body.
-
Be careful that there is no cold taken, or overexposure, during any of these treatments; that is, of getting the feet wet, sitting in drafts, or of over exercise.
-
Do these for the body, [1882].
-
Ready for questions.
-
(Q) Just one Epsom Salts Bath? (A) One Epsom Salts Bath should be sufficient. If there is not a relief from the headaches, or from the conditions through the limbs, then this may be repeated.
-
We are through for the present.

R1. 6/3/39 Son’s Letter:
Brooklyn
Dear Mr. Cacey [Cayce];
Thank you very much for your reading and all the interest you have shown.
Referring to your reading, at that date only mother had definite pains in the limphs [lymphs? limbs?], but it is not a general condition. She also does suffer from any severe headaches. Her case history is this: 22 years ago she was operated on the gallbladder. 10 years ago she had a very severe Angina Pectoris. One year ago it was Thrombo-Flebitis [phlebitis] with amboulis [embolis].
Her heart is at present as stated by physicians after an electro cardiogram, organically healthy, but there is a nervous heart-muscle weakness indicated. She also suffers from breathlessness and weakness, as result is not permitted to take any walks or climb stairs nor do any work. In your procedure for treatment you advise a hot epsom salt bath. Do you think it’s safe for her to do that? Mother also cannot eat many things, she vomits quite easily and gets pains in her stomach at about the position where liver is or where formerly gallbladder used to be, when eating anything not agreeable.
Mr. Caycey [Cayce], you have to forgive my delayed answer, but since your reading my sister gave birth to a little girl, and we all were quite anxious as hers was a very complicated case.
I again thank you for all your troubles and indulgence and shall await further instructions.
Sincerely Yours, […]

B1. 4/21/39 [1826]‘s husband’s ltr. to EC: ”…I have informed a number of people of the [meeting], most of whom said they would attend - among them will be, I hope a cousin […]. It was my suggestion that he make your acquaintance. His mother [1882], has been ill for some time. She has had medical advice without any improvement in her condition. I would appreciate it if you would render service in this case for a lesser amount than usually charged. This family are some of the refugees that came from Germany three and half years ago. The two boys are trying to provide for their family - five in number. I trust this request will not be considered as unreasonable or impertinent for truly it will be a contribution to a persecuted people. I believe the boys will be glad to pay about $10. - would pay more if they were financially able…”
B2. 4/29/39 EC’s reply to ltr.: ”…Met your cousin - a very lovely young man - had talk with him and have an appointment for the reading - sincerely trust we may be of some help…”
B3. 5/8/39 Son of Mrs. [1882] sent signed application, remitting one dollar.
